12. 6    evn    2   3     Maintaining the Washing Machine    Draining the washing machine in an emergency       Unplug the washing machine  from the power supply    Open the filter cover by using  a coin or a key           Unscrew the emergency drain cap  by turning left  Grip the cap on the  end of the emergency drain tube  and slowly pull it out about 15 cm           Allow all the water to flow into a bowl   Reinsert the drain tube and screw the cap back on   Replace the filter cover     Repairing a frozen washing machine  If the temperature drops below freezing and your washing machine is frozen     Unplug the washing machine    Pour warm water on the source faucet to loosen the water supply hose    Remove the water supply hose and soak it in warm water    Pour warm water into the washing machine drum and let it sit for 10 minutes   Reconnect the water supply hose to the water faucet and check if the water supply  and drain operations are normal     Cleaning the exterior  1     Wipe the washing machine surfaces  including the control panel  with a soft cloth  and non abrasive household detergents    Use a soft cloth to dry the surfaces    Do not pour water on the washing machine     12 S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ions       Cleaning the detergent drawer and recess  1     Yow    E       Cleaning the debris filter    Clean the debris filter 5 or 6 times a year  or when you see the following error message on  the display     1        2     3     4     5        Maint
13. aining the Washing Machine    Press the release lever on the inside  of the detergent drawer and pull it out     Remove the cap from compartment       Wash all of the parts under running water   Clean the drawer recess with an old toothbrush     Reinsert the cap  Pushing it firmly into place   and replace the liquid detergent divider into the drawer     Push the drawer back into place     Run a rinse program without any laundry in the drum                 Open the filter cover   See    Draining the washing machine in an emergency  on page 13     Unscrew emergency drain cap by turning left and drain off all the water   See  Draining the washing machine in an emergency  on page 13     Unscrew the filter cap and take it out           Wash any dirt or other material from the filter  Make sure the drain pump propeller  behind the filter is not blocked  Replace the filter cap     Replace the filter cover        S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ions 13          Maintaining the Washing Machine    Cleaning the water hose mesh filter    You should clean the water hose mesh filter at least one time per year  or when you see the  following error message on the display     To do this     1  Turn off the water source to the washing machine     2  Unscrew the hose from the back of the washing machine     3  With a pair of pliers  gently pull out the mesh filter from the end of the hose and rinse    it under water until clean  Also clean the inside and outside of the threaded  conne
14. ctor         J  O  A  fs   gt    d  N    4  Push the filter back into place                                 5  Screw the hose back onto the washing machine     6  Turn on the faucet and make sure the connections are watertight        14 S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ions          Troubleshooting    Problems and solutions   The washing machine will not start  e Make sure the door is firmly closed   e Make sure the washing machine is plugged in   e Make sure the water source faucet is turned on   e Make sure to press the Start   Pause button     No water or insufficient water supply  e Make sure the water source faucet is turned on   e Make sure the water source hose is not frozen   e Make sure the water intake hose is not bent   e Make sure the filter on the water intake hose is not clogged     Detergent remains in the detergent drawer after the wash  program is complete  e Make sure the washing machine is running with sufficient water pressure   e Put the detergents in the inner parts of the detergent drawer away from the  outside edges      Washing machine vibrates or is too noisy  Make sure the washing machine is set on a level surface  If the surface is not level   adjust the washing machine feet to level the appliance   e Make sure that the shipping bolts are removed   e Make sure the washing machine is not touching any other object   e Make sure the laundry load is balanced     The washing machine does not drain and or spin  e Make sure the drain hose is not

21. items can damage linen  the  washing machine drum  and the water tank     Securing fasteners   Close zippers and fasten buttons or hooks  loose belts or ribbons    should be tied together     Prewashing cotton   Your new washing machine  combined with modern detergents   will give perfect washing results  thus saving energy  time  water and detergent  However   if your cotton is particularly dirty  use a prewash with a protein based detergent     Determining load capacity  Do not overload the washing machine or your laundry  may not wash properly  Use the chart below to determine the load capacity for the type of    laundry you are washing        Fabric Type Load Capacity  J1045A   J845A  Coloured   cotton   average   lightly soiled 7 0 kg   heavily soiled 7 0 kg  Synthetics 4 0 kg  Delicates 2 5 kg  Wools 2 0 kg    Detergent tips  The type of detergent you should use is based on the type of fabric   cotton  synthetic  delicate items  wool   colour  wash temperature  degree and type of  soiling  Always use  low suds  laundry soap  which is designed for automatic washing    machines     Follow the detergent manufacturer s recommendations based upon the weight of the  laundry  the degree of soiling  and the hardness of the water in your area  If you do not  know how hard your water is  ask your water authority     Note  Keep detergents and additives in a safe  dry place out of the reach of children           S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ions 11             4   5   
22. k s hot water  faucet and tighten it by hand   3  Use a Y piece if you only want to use cold water     Note  The appliance is to be connected to the water mains using new hose sets and that  old hose sets should not be used     Positioning the drain hose  The end of the drain hose may be positioned in three ways   Over the edge of a sink                      The drain hose must be placed at a height of 2 EN  between 60 and 90 cm  To keep the drain hose q    spout bent  use the supplied plastic hose a  guide  Secure the guide to the wall with a o_o _0 TF  hook or to the faucet with a piece of string to  prevent the drain hose from moving                             In a sink drain pipe branch    The drain pipe branch must be above the sink siphon so that the end of the hose is at least  60 cm above the ground     In a drain pipe    Samsung recommends that you use a 65 cm high vertical pipe  it must be no shorter than 60  cm and no longer than 90 cm     4 S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ions          Installing the Washing Machine    Plugging in the machine    For European Users  You will NOT need to ground the plug of the washing machine     For U S  Users  Yo  MUST ground the plug of the washing machine     Check with a licensed electrician before using the machine to make sure it is properly  grounded     For U K  Users     Wiring Instructions  WARNING THIS APPLIANCE MUST BE EARTHED     This appliance must be earthed  In the event of an    electrical short circuit

26. the Start   Pause button and the machine will begin the cycle     Using Delay Start    You can set the washing machine to finish your wash automatically at a later time  choosing    from    3 to 24 hour delay  in 1 hour increments   Displayed hours means the time of finished    washing cycle   To do this     1     2   3     Manually or automatically set your washing machine for the type of clothes you are  washing    Press the Delay Start button repeatedly until the delay time is set    Press the Start Pause button  The Delay Start indicator will light  and the clock will  begin counting down until it reaches your finish time    To cancel Delay Start  press the     On Off  button  then turn the washing machine  on again     10 SAMSUNG Washing Machine Owner   s Instructions          Washing a Load of Laundry    Washing tips and hints    Sorting your laundry   Sort your laundry according to the following characteristics   e Type of fabric care label symbol   Sort laundry into cottons  mixed fibers  synthetics   silks  wools and rayon     e Colour   Divide whites and colours  Wash new  coloured items separately   e Size  Placing items of different sizes in the same load will improve the washing action     e Sensitivity  Wash delicate items separately  using the Delicate wash program for pure  new wool  curtains and silk articles  Check the labels on the items you are washing or  refer to the fabric care chart in the appendix     Emptying pockets   Coins  safety pins and similar
